Texas A&M picked up a big-time commitment in the class of 2025 on Saturday night.

The Aggies landed 4-star safety prospect Deyjhon Pettaway over several other top programs from across the country. Pettaway chose Texas A&M over offers from places such as Ohio State, Georgia and Miami, amongst others.

Pettaway is a huge addition to Texas A&M’s 2025 recruiting class. He’s the No. 138 overall player and the No. 11 safety in the country for the class of 2025, per 247Sports Composite rankings. He’s also the No. 24 player from the state of Texas.

Pettaway attends Paetow High School in Katy, Texas. He’s listed at 5-foot-10, 175 pounds. Pettaway has not yet made his official visit to College Station, but he has taken multiple trips to campus on unofficial visits over the last year.

Texas A&M now has 3 commitments in the class of 2025. Pettaway is the second 4-star prospect to commit to the Aggies this week, joining linebacker Kelvion Riggins. Texas A&M also has a pledge from 3-star offensive lineman Joshua Moses.
